Obituary for Raymond Theodore (Ted) Smay
Raymond Theodore “Ted” Smay 50, of Waynesboro passed away Sunday December 28. 2014.
Born November 6, 1964 in Clearfield he was the son of Clyde Sr. and Vera “Peg” (Stoy) Smay. He had worked for various construction companies most recently for Frederick Ceilings in Waynesboro as a dry wall installer.
He was a very hard worker and was a devoted Dallas Cowboys fan. He also enjoyed his gardening. And was a member of Blue Ridge Sportsmen Association in Fairfield, PA.
He is survived by his father Clyde Smay Sr. and his wife Marcia of Clearfield, step father Wiliam Stoy of Ashville, 5 brothers and sisters Clyde Smay Jr. and his wife Kimberly of Curwensille, Kim Dimmick and her husband Greg of Kerrmoor, Cindy Ireland and her husband Tom of Curwensville, Vonda Evans and her husband Mike, and Autumn Farley and her husband Randy all of Clearfield. And numerous nieces and nephews.
He was preceded in death by his mother Vera “Peg” Stoy, a brother Garland Smay, and a lifelong friend Amy Russell.
A public memorial services will be held at the Chester C. Chidboy Funeral Home, Inc. of Curwensville on Saturday January 3, 2015 at 11:00 AM with Mr. Richard Smay officiating.
Friends will be received at the Funeral Home on Saturday from 10 AM till the time of services at 11 AM.
